About This Book
Rain pounds down, wind howls, and two men race to finish their houses. One stands firm on a rock, the other struggles with shifting sand. What will happen when the storm hits?

Quick Assessment
This early reader adapts a classic Bible story about wisdom and careful planning, suitable for children ages 5 to 8. It introduces moral lessons through simple text and engaging illustrations, making it accessible for young readers. The story contains no intense content and emphasizes themes of resilience and thoughtful choices.
